A KEY figure in the world of politics is to talk about his life to a Dorchester audience.

An Evening with Vince Cable comes to Dorchester Corn Exchange on Friday, December 1 at 7.30pm.

A major politician, a key figure for five years in the Coalition Cabinet as Secretary of State for Business Innovation and Skills, Leader of the Liberal Democrat party – this Lib Dem political titan will be talking to journalist and presenter Matt Stadlen about his life then and his life now.

When not working, he is a father and grandfather and a competitive ballroom and dancer (who once earned 10/10 from Len and Craig on a Christmas edition of Strictly), but who is The Rt Hon Sir Vince Cable MP?

Having retired from Parliament after 20 years as MP, Vince now writes books on political and economic matters, is a Visiting Professor at the LSE; a Distinguished Fellow of the Overseas Development; and Director of a company creating a hydrogen refuelling network as part of the net zero economy.
